WHAT YOU’LL DO
As the Director of Nursing, you will be the senior nursing leader responsible for the performance, development, and strategic direction of a large (>250 RNs), remote, multi-speciality (oncology, CCM, palliative care) nursing workforce. Operating within a value-based cancer care navigation model, the Director of Nursing ensures that nursing practice is standardized, scalable, and aligned with the company's quality, member experience, and contractual performance goals. This is a high-impact role for a leader who thrives at the intersection of people leadership, systems thinking, and clinical accountability in a fast-paced environment. This role reports to our SVP of Clinical Innovation & Delivery Design.

Our salary ranges are based on paying competitively for our size and industry, and are one part of the total compensation package that also includes equity, benefits, and other opportunities at Thyme Care. Individual pay decisions are based on several factors, including qualifications, experience level, skillset, and balancing internal equity relative to other Thyme Care employees. The base salary for this role is $153,000-$180,000. The salary range could be lower or higher than this if the role is hired at another level.
